What if the key to reducing inflammation, balancing hormones, improving digestion, and restoring your energy wasn't another restrictive diet—but ancient wisdom backed by modern science? In this powerful episode of The Girlfriend Doctor Show, Dr. Anna Cabeca sits down with Ayurvedic practitioner, turmeric researcher, and inflammation expert Dr. Shivani Gupta to explore how chronic inflammation silently impacts everything from brain fog and belly fat to hormone imbalance, sleep struggles, and burnout in midlife women. With a Master's in Ayurvedic Sciences and a PhD focused on turmeric, Dr. Shivani bridges the gap between ancient Ayurvedic practices and functional medicine in a refreshingly practical way. Together, Dr. Anna and Dr. Shivani dive into the daily rituals, spice-based habits, and nervous system practices that can help women feel vibrant again—without perfection or deprivation. In this episode, you'll learn: Why inflammation is often the hidden root cause behind hormone chaos and fatigue The surprising connection between gut health, the estrobolome, and menopause symptoms How turmeric works beyond supplements—and why quality matters What "Mental Inflammation™" is and how stress fuels physical symptoms Simple Ayurvedic micro-habits that help regulate energy, digestion, mood, and sleep How women can personalize wellness through Elemental Design™ instead of one-size-fits-all health advice Dr. Shivani also shares insights from her upcoming book, The Inflammation Code (Hay House, February 2026), and explains why sustainable healing starts with small daily shifts that actually fit real life.
